How do you cite the English Standard Bible in MLA?

How do you cite the ESV Bible in MLA? The MLA 8 citation for the English Standard Version (ESV) Study Bible would be formatted like: Study Bible-ESV. English Standard Version, Crossway Bibles, 2014.

How do you cite a Bible version?

Works Cited Citation for a Print Version of the Bible Edited by Editor’s First and Last Name, Bible Version, Publisher, Year of Publication. Example: Holy Bible. New International Version, Zondervan Publishing House, 1984.

How do you cite the Bible in MLA 7?

References to the Bible should follow the format below: Name of Editor, ed. City of Publication, State if not well-known city: Publisher, Date. Source and Medium of Publication. * Note: Citations are single-spaced here, but be sure to double-space your Works Cited page.

How do you cite a study Bible note?

This person’s name can be found in the beginning of the book or at the front of the Bible. The notes should be cited like they come from an article written by the person in the edited volume that is the Bible.

How do you cite the Bible in MLA 8?

Italicize “The Bible” and follow it with the version you are using. Remember that your in-text (parenthetical citation) should include the name of the specific edition of the Bible, followed by an abbreviation of the book, the chapter and verse(s).

How do you cite the Bible in an essay?

Typical Bible citations will include the title of the Bible, editor/translator (when relevant), the version (if different from the title) and/or edition, publisher, year, URL (for online editions). Examples: ESV Study Bible. English Standard Version, Crossway, 2011. Holy Bible. King James Version, Reference ed., Thru the Bible Radio, 1976.

How do you cite the Bible in APA 7th edition?

To cite the Bible in 7th edition APA Style, use the general book citation format, omitting the author element and listing the specific version used (not just “The Bible”) as the title. Include a URL if you accessed an online version.
